On Fri, 17 Jan 2020 15:08:55 +0530
Ganesh Goudar <ganeshgr@linux.ibm.com> wrote:

> From: Aravinda Prasad <arawinda.p@gmail.com>
> 
> This patch sets the default value of SPAPR_CAP_FWNMI_MCE
> to SPAPR_CAP_ON for machine type 4.2.
> 

Now that 4.2 has been released, we want this for 5.0...

> Signed-off-by: Aravinda Prasad <arawinda.p@gmail.com>
> Signed-off-by: Ganesh Goudar <ganeshgr@linux.ibm.com>
> ---
>  hw/ppc/spapr.c | 3 ++-
>  1 file changed, 2 insertions(+), 1 deletion(-)
> 
> diff --git a/hw/ppc/spapr.c b/hw/ppc/spapr.c
> index c8bc2fa9f3..a81c18b6b6 100644
> --- a/hw/ppc/spapr.c
> +++ b/hw/ppc/spapr.c
> @@ -4454,7 +4454,7 @@ static void spapr_machine_class_init(ObjectClass *oc, void *data)
>      smc->default_caps.caps[SPAPR_CAP_NESTED_KVM_HV] = SPAPR_CAP_OFF;
>      smc->default_caps.caps[SPAPR_CAP_LARGE_DECREMENTER] = SPAPR_CAP_ON;
>      smc->default_caps.caps[SPAPR_CAP_CCF_ASSIST] = SPAPR_CAP_OFF;
> -    smc->default_caps.caps[SPAPR_CAP_FWNMI_MCE] = SPAPR_CAP_OFF;
> +    smc->default_caps.caps[SPAPR_CAP_FWNMI_MCE] = SPAPR_CAP_ON;
>      spapr_caps_add_properties(smc, &error_abort);
>      smc->irq = &spapr_irq_dual;
>      smc->dr_phb_enabled = true;
> @@ -4544,6 +4544,7 @@ static void spapr_machine_4_1_class_options(MachineClass *mc)
>      smc->smp_threads_vsmt = false;
>      compat_props_add(mc->compat_props, hw_compat_4_1, hw_compat_4_1_len);
>      compat_props_add(mc->compat_props, compat, G_N_ELEMENTS(compat));
> +    smc->default_caps.caps[SPAPR_CAP_FWNMI_MCE] = SPAPR_CAP_OFF;

... this should go to spapr_machine_4_2_class_options().

>  }
>  
>  DEFINE_SPAPR_MACHINE(4_1, "4.1", false);
